PostgreSQL: soi kèo bóng đá truoctran liệu: | |||
---|---|---|---|
prev | UP | Chương 49. Danh mục hệ thống | Tiếp theo |
Danh mụcpg_typeLưu trữ thông tin về các kèo bóng đá việt nam dữ liệu. Các kèo bóng đá việt nam cơ sở và các kèo bóng đá việt nam enum (kèo bóng đá việt nam vô hướng) được tạo bằngPostgreSQL: Tài liệu: 9.5:và các miền vớiPostgreSQL: Tài. Một kèo bóng đá việt nam tổng hợp được tự động tạo cho mỗi bảng trong cơ sở dữ liệu, để biểu thị cấu trúc hàng của bảng. Cũng có thể tạo các kèo bóng đá việt nam tổng hợp vớiTạo kèo bóng đá việt nam dưới dạng.
Bảng 49-54.pg_typecột
tên | kèo bóng đá việt nam | Tài liệu tham khảo | Mô tả |
---|---|---|---|
oid | oid | định danh hàng (thuộc tính ẩn; phải được chọn rõ ràng) | |
TYPNAME | tên | 11498_11514 | |
Không gian danh mục | oid | PostgreSQL: kèo bóng đá euro liệu:.oid | oid của không gian tên có chứa kèo bóng đá việt nam này |
Typowner | oid | pg_authid.oid | Chủ sở hữu của kèo bóng đá việt nam |
Typlen | INT2 | Đối với kèo bóng đá việt nam kích thước cố định,Typlenlà số byte trong biểu diễn nội bộ của kèo bóng đá việt nam. Nhưng đối với một kèo bóng đá việt nam có độ dài thay đổi,Typlenlà âm. -1 chỉ ra một"Varlena"kèo bóng đá việt nam (một từ có từ dài), -2 chỉ ra chuỗi C được chấm dứt null. | |
typbyval | bool | typbyvalXác định xem các thói quen nội bộ có truyền giá trị của kèo bóng đá việt nam này theo giá trị hay theo tham chiếu.typbyvaltốt hơn là sai nếu12803_12811không phải là 1, 2 hoặc 4 (hoặc 8 trên các máy trong đó mốc dữ liệu là 8 byte). Các kèo bóng đá việt nam có độ dài thay đổi luôn được truyền qua tham chiếu. Lưu ý rằngTYPBYVALcó thể sai ngay cả khi độ dài cho phép có giá trị vượt qua. | |
Typtype | char | TyptypelàBĐối với kèo bóng đá việt nam cơ sở,CĐối với kèo bóng đá việt nam tổng hợp (ví dụ: kèo bóng đá việt nam hàng của bảng),Dcho một miền,Echo một kèo bóng đá việt nam enum,Pcho một kèo bóng đá việt nam giả hoặcRĐối với kèo bóng đá việt nam phạm vi. Xem thêmTyPrelidvàtypbasetype. | |
TYPC Category | Char | TYPC Categorylà một phân kèo bóng đá việt nam tùy ý các kèo bóng đá việt nam dữ liệu được sử dụng bởi trình phân tích cú pháp để xác định các diễn viên ngầm nên là"ưa thích". Nhìn thấyBảng 49-55. | |
Typispreferred | bool | Đúng nếu kèo bóng đá việt nam là mục tiêu đúc ưa thích trongTYPC Category | |
TypisDefined | bool | Đúng nếu kèo bóng đá việt nam được xác định, sai nếu đây là mục nhập trình giữ chỗ cho kèo bóng đá việt nam chưa được xác định. KhiTypisDefinedlà sai, không có gì ngoại trừ tên kèo bóng đá việt nam, không gian tên và OID có thể được dựa vào. | |
typdelim | Char | ký tự phân tách hai giá trị của kèo bóng đá việt nam này khi phân tích đầu vào mảng phân tích. Lưu ý rằng dấu phân cách được liên kết với kiểu dữ liệu phần tử mảng, không phải kiểu dữ liệu mảng. | |
TyPrelid | oid | pg_ class.oid | Nếu đây là kèo bóng đá việt nam tổng hợp (xemTyptype), sau đó cột này trỏ đếnpg_ classMục xác định bảng tương ứng. (Đối với kèo bóng đá việt nam tổng hợp đứng tự do,pg_ classMục nhập không thực sự đại diện cho một bảng, nhưng dù sao nó cũng cần thiết cho kèo bóng đá việt namPG_AttributionMục nhập liên kết đến.) Không cho các kèo bóng đá việt nam không hợp đồng. |
Typelem | oid | pg_type.oid | 15694_15699Typelemkhông phải 0 thì nó xác định một hàng khác trongPG_TYPE. kèo bóng đá việt nam hiện tại sau đó có thể được đăng ký như một giá trị năng suất mảng của kèo bóng đá việt namTypelem. MỘT"True"kèo bóng đá việt nam mảng là độ dài thay đổi (Typlen= -1), nhưng một số độ dài cố định (Typlen16099_16134Typelem, ví dụtênvàđiểm. Nếu một kèo bóng đá việt nam có độ dài cố định có mộtTypelemSau đó, biểu diễn nội bộ của nó phải là một số giá trị củaTypelemKiểu dữ liệu không có dữ liệu khác. Các kèo bóng đá việt nam mảng có độ dài thay đổi có tiêu đề được xác định bởi các chương trình con mảng. |
Typarray | oid | PG_TYPE.oid | nếuTyparraykhông phải 0 thì nó xác định một hàng khác trongPG_TYPE, đó là"True"kèo bóng đá việt nam mảng có kèo bóng đá việt nam này là phần tử |
TypInput | RegProc | PG_PROC.oid | Hàm chuyển đổi đầu vào (định dạng văn bản) |
TypOutput | RegProc | PG_PROC.oid | 17410_17452 |
TyPreceive | RegProc | PG_PROC.oid | Hàm chuyển đổi đầu vào (định dạng nhị phân) hoặc 0 nếu không |
TYPSEND | RegProc | PG_PROC.oid | Hàm chuyển đổi đầu ra (định dạng nhị phân) hoặc 0 nếu không |
typmodin | RegProc | PG_PROC.oid | Chức năng đầu vào kèo bóng đá việt nam sửa đổi hoặc 0 nếu kèo bóng đá việt nam không hỗ trợ sửa đổi |
TypModout | RegProc | PG_PROC.oid | Chức năng đầu ra kèo bóng đá việt nam sửa đổi hoặc 0 để sử dụng định dạng tiêu chuẩn |
typanalyze | RegProc | PG_PROC.oid | tùy chỉnhPhân tíchHàm hoặc 0 để sử dụng hàm tiêu chuẩn |
Typalign | Char |
Typalignlà căn chỉnh cần thiết khi lưu trữ giá trị của kèo bóng đá việt nam này. Nó áp dụng cho lưu trữ trên đĩa cũng như hầu hết các biểu diễn của giá trị bên trongPostgreSQL. Khi nhiều giá trị được lưu trữ liên tiếp, chẳng hạn như trong biểu diễn của một hàng hoàn chỉnh trên đĩa, phần đệm được chèn trước một mốc thời gian này để nó bắt đầu trên ranh giới được chỉ định. Tham chiếu căn chỉnh là sự khởi đầu của mốc dữ liệu đầu tiên trong chuỗi. Giá trị có thể là:
|
|
Typstorage | Char |
TypstorageKể cho các kèo bóng đá việt nam Varlena (những kèo bóng đá việt nam cóTyplen= -1) Nếu kèo bóng đá việt nam được chuẩn bị để nướng và chiến lược mặc định cho các thuộc tính của kèo bóng đá việt nam này nên là gì. Các giá trị có thể là
Lưu ý rằngMCột cũng có thể được chuyển ra lưu trữ thứ cấp, nhưng chỉ là phương sách cuối cùng (EvàxCột được di chuyển trước). |
|
TYPNOTNULL | bool |
TYPNOTNULLđại diện cho một ràng buộc không có null trên một kèo bóng đá việt nam. Chỉ được sử dụng cho các miền. |
|
typbasetype | oid | pg_type.oid |
Nếu đây là miền (xemTyptype), sau đótypbasetypeXác định kèo bóng đá việt nam mà kèo bóng đá việt nam này dựa trên. Số không nếu kèo bóng đá việt nam này không phải là miền. |
typtypmod | INT4 |
Sử dụng tên miềnTypTyPModĐể ghi lạiTYPMODđược áp dụng cho kèo bóng đá việt nam cơ sở của chúng (-1 nếu kèo bóng đá việt nam cơ sở không sử dụngTYPMOD). -1 nếu kèo bóng đá việt nam này không phải là miền. |
|
typndims | INT4 |
typndimslà số lượng kích thước mảng cho một miền trên một mảng (nghĩa làtypbasetypelà kèo bóng đá việt nam mảng). Số không cho các kèo bóng đá việt nam khác với miền trên các kèo bóng đá việt nam mảng. |
|
TypCollation | OID | PostgreSQL: Tài.oid |
TypCollationChỉ định đối chiếu của kèo bóng đá việt nam. Nếu kèo bóng đá việt nam không hỗ trợ đối chiếu, điều này sẽ bằng không. Một kèo bóng đá việt nam cơ sở hỗ trợ các đối chiếu sẽ códefault_collation_oidở đây. Một tên miền trên một kèo bóng đá việt nam có thể có có thể có một số đối chiếu khác, nếu một tên được chỉ định cho miền. |
typdefaultbin | pg_node_tree |
nếutypdefaultbinkhông phải là null, đó là |
|
typdefault | Text |
typdefaultlà null nếu kèo bóng đá việt nam không có giá trị mặc định liên quan. Nếu nhưtypdefaultbinkhông phải là null,typdefaultPhải chứa phiên bản có thể đọc được của người của biểu thức mặc định được biểu thị bởitypdefaultbin. Nếu nhưtypdefaultbinlà null vàtypdefaultkhông, sau đótypdefaultlà biểu diễn bên ngoài của giá trị mặc định của kèo bóng đá việt nam, có thể được đưa vào bộ chuyển đổi đầu vào của kèo bóng đá việt nam để tạo ra một hằng số. |
|
TYPACL | aclitem [] | Đặc quyền truy cập; nhìn thấyGrantvàthu hồiĐể biết chi tiết |
Bảng 49-55liệt kê các giá trị được xác định bởi hệ thống củaTYPC Category. Bất kỳ bổ sung trong tương lai cho danh sách này cũng sẽ là các chữ cái ASCII trên trường hợp trên. Tất cả các ký tự ASCII khác được dành riêng cho các danh mục do người dùng xác định.
25072_25087TYPC Categorymã
Code | thể kèo bóng đá việt nam |
---|---|
A | Các kèo bóng đá việt nam mảng |
B | Các kèo bóng đá việt nam Boolean |
C | Các kèo bóng đá việt nam tổng hợp |
D | Các kèo bóng đá việt nam ngày/giờ |
E | Các kèo bóng đá việt nam enum |
g | Các kèo bóng đá việt nam hình học |
i | Các kèo bóng đá việt nam địa chỉ mạng |
n | Các kèo bóng đá việt nam số |
P | Pseudo-Types |
R | phạm vi kèo bóng đá việt nam |
25996_25999 | chuỗi kèo bóng đá việt nam |
T | Các kèo bóng đá việt nam thời gian |
u | Các kèo bóng đá việt nam do người dùng xác định |
V | Các kèo bóng đá việt nam chuỗi bit |
x | không xác địnhkèo bóng đá việt nam |